B / 01

Hot-call dispatch

Loud alert, priority pane, one-button ACK. Your unit lights, your unit sounds.

B / 02

NCIC & state lookups

Persons, plates, VINs, articles, guns, boats. Tap once. Hits surface front-and-center.

B / 03

Routing & AVL

Turn-by-turn to the call with traffic and incident-aware re-routing. Other units stay visible.

B / 04

BWC integration

One-tap recording start with the incident ID stamped into the BWC metadata.

B / 05

Status & queue

10-codes / status codes mapped to your agency’s exact vocabulary. Queue persists offline.

B / 06

Offline-tolerant

Lose signal between two towers — your queue, status, and notes survive. Syncs on reconnect.

B / 07

LMR + MCPTT in-cab

Push-to-talk against Telex / C-Soft or MCPTT 3GPP. Same talk-groups as the dispatcher.

B / 08

Field reports

Start the report from the call. Auto-fills people, vehicles, location, and times.

B / 09

10-33 panic

One-button officer-down. Location, channel, and unit broadcast to every console and peer.

Tested
where it lives.

Native Tauri Windows client. GPU-accelerated UI. Locally cached incident state. Tuned for the latency profiles of LTE and FirstNet in moving vehicles. Glove-friendly tap targets — no hit area under 44×44 pixels.

PlatformWindows 10/11 (Tauri native)
HardwareGetac, Panasonic Toughbook, Dell rugged
NetworksLTE, FirstNet Band 14, Wi-Fi, cached fallback
LookupsNCIC, state CJIS feeds, locals
AVL1Hz GPS · in-vehicle dead-reckoning
BWCAxon, Motorola, generic ONVIF
RadioMCPTT, Telex, C-Soft
ComplianceCJIS Advanced Auth · MFA · FIPS 140-2
